Light sensors on your monitor automatically control the brightness feature by getting information based on ambient lighting. "Adaptive Brightness" is a Windows 7 service that "Monitors ambient light sensors to detect changes in ambient light and adjust the display brightness. If the above option is missing or you’re using an old version of Windows, open the Power Options window from the Control Panel and expand the Display item, you can turn off the “Enable adaptive brightness” setting. For example indoors, away from windows it will dim the display, and standing outside in sunlight it will brighten the display. Atom ghz. Latitude.
